Maximizing Space with Strategic L Shapes
An L shaped outdoor kitchen leverages natural corners to create distinct zones—cooking, prep, and seating—within a compact footprint. Positioning the longer arm for appliances like a small grill or induction cooktop and the shorter arm for a dining nook or coffee station ensures workflow efficiency while maintaining an open feel. This layout enhances usability without feeling cluttered, ideal for urban patios or small yards.
Smart Storage Solutions for Small Kitchens
In a small L kitchen, every storage detail matters. Built-in cabinets, overhead shelves, and pull-out drawers keep utensils, spices, and tools accessible yet out of sight. Hidden countertops, magnetic knife strips, and foldable islands double as workspace and temporary seating. Prioritizing vertical storage and modular components keeps the space neat and scalable as needs evolve.
Integrating Aesthetic and Functional Elements
Blending visual appeal with practicality defines successful small outdoor kitchens. Use durable materials like weather-resistant stone, teak, or stainless steel to withstand the elements while offering timeless beauty. Incorporate ambient lighting such as string lights or recessed fixtures to extend usability into evenings. Add greenery with potted herbs or vertical gardens to soften the space and enhance freshness.
